Rhetoric is the effective use of language. It is ancient, tracing back to the early Greek philosophers who developed rhetoric for law and democratic politics. Rhetoric is an essential tool of advocacy but also collaboration, leadership, building community, and the discovery and testing of new ideas. Ultimately, it shapes our understanding of the world around us. Life is a series of opportunities disguised as challenges. Our experience of life depends, in large part, on how we respond to them. Politics, Parks, and Potholes is a guidebook to getting what you want from your local government. It is aimed at everyday residents who, until a problem arises, pay little or no attention to their city council or county board of supervisors. Then something triggers their concern and they don’t know how to engage in the process. Written by two former elected officials, the book takes a nonpartisan approach to helping residents who do not want to run for office or organize large protest movements.
